    Easy Chicken Parmesan Recipe

    Ingredients

    1 Kraft Fresh Take Italian Parmesan kit

    6 boneless, skinless chicken breasts

    1 package of fettuccine

    1 jar of marinara sauce

    Garlic bread

    Directions

    Preheat your oven to 375 degrees.

    I personally buy Tyson Grilled and Ready chicken breasts because there is no cooking time - you just open the Kraft Fresh Take kit, mix the cheese and seasonings by shaking the pouch a bit, then add each chicken breast, seal and shake to coat it evenly.

    easy chicken parmesan recipe using kraft #freshtake

    Repeat with each chicken breast until they are all coated with the Kraft Fresh Take mixture.

    Lay them on a baking pan lined with tinfoil (for easy clean up) and cook for 20 minutes.

    easy chicken parmesan recipe using kraft #freshtake

    While your chicken breasts are baking, bring a pot of water to a rolling boil and add your fettuccine, and cook until al dente, or about 12 minutes.

    Once the pasta is done, drain the water and return to the stove on low heat and add your marinara sauce to the pasta, stirring to ensure that the sauce heats through.
